House Democrats Rep. Mike McIntyre (D-NC), and Rep. Dan Lipinski (D-IL) have joined Tea Party backed Rep. Paul Labrador (R-ID) and 57 other Republican co-sponsors in introducing the “Marriage And Religious Freedom Act.” The bill would ban the federal government from taking any “adverse action” against the opponents of same-sex marriage.
The purpose of the bill is to let individual federal employees, contractors, and grantees refuse to do their jobs or fulfill the terms of their taxpayer-funded contracts because because they have a religious view about certain lawfully-married gay couples, or LGBT individuals – and then to sue the federal government for damages if they don’t get their way.
